Types of Daycares:
There are various types of daycares readily available, each catering to different requirements and choices. Some typically common types of daycares feature:
- In-home Daycares: they are usually run by someone or family members in their own personal house. They offer a more personal setting with a diminished child-to-caregiver proportion.
- Childcare Centers: they are larger services that appeal to a bigger wide range of kids. They could offer even more structured programs and activities.
- Preschools: they are much like childcare centers but focus more on early training and school ability.
- Montessori institutes: These schools follow the Montessori method of education, which emphasizes autonomy, self-directed understanding, and hands-on activities.
Services Granted:
Daycares provide a variety of services to meet the needs of working moms and dads and provide a nurturing environment for the kids. Some common solutions made available from daycares feature:
- Full-day care: Many daycares provide full-day maintain working moms and dads, supplying care from morning until night.
- Part-time care: Some daycares provide part-time treatment options for parents who just need care for a few days a week or a couple of hours a-day.
- Early knowledge: Many daycares provide early education programs that give attention to school preparedness and intellectual development.
- Nutritionally beneficial dishes: Some daycares provide healthy meals and snacks for kids during the day.
Facilities:
The services at a daycare play a crucial role in offering a secure and stimulating environment for children. Some things to consider whenever evaluating daycare services include:
- Cleanliness: The daycare must certanly be clean and well-maintained to guarantee the safe practices of this kids.
- Security precautions: The daycare needs to have security precautions positioned, like childproofing, secure entrances, and disaster procedures.
- Play areas: The daycare must have age-appropriate play places and gear for kids to engage in physical exercise and play.
- Learning materials: The Daycare Near Me By State should have a variety of mastering materials, books, and toys to advertise intellectual development and creativity.
Costs:
The price of daycare can vary depending on the kind of daycare, location, and solutions supplied. Some elements that may affect the cost of daycare feature:
- Sort of daycare: In-home daycares can be less expensive than childcare facilities or preschools.
- Area: Daycares in urban areas or high-cost-of-living areas may have greater fees.
- Services supplied: Daycares that provide additional solutions, such as early knowledge programs or meals, could have greater costs.
- Subsidies: Some families can be entitled to subsidies or monetary assistance to help protect the expense of daycare.
